Putting family farmers at the centre to achieve the SDGs

With affirmative frameworks in place, family farmers can play a pivotal role in simultaneously contributing to the economic, environmental, social and cultural sustainability of agriculture and rural areas. The United Nations Decade of Family Farming 2019-2028 (UNDFF) serves as a framework for countries to develop public policies and investments to support family farming from a holistic perspective, unleashing the transformative potential of family farmers to contribute to achieving the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s).
